Library – Maker Space
Librarians Maureen Barclay and Dani Long began planning a MakerSpace in April 2022. We were inspired by LASL conference presenters, and we put our resourcefulness to great use in this project! We completed construction on the MakerSpace room where our mobile storage (formerly a bookshelf on casters!) displays items for student use and provides students with work space, work benches, tools, a painted green screen wall, and white boards to plan and build their designs.
With support from DonorsChoose, district Teacher Technology, our own local funds, and some old-fashioned elbow grease, we have remodeled and stocked the MakerSpace with materials and equipment to support innovation in engineering design and the arts. We have two 3D printers for student use!
Lunch & Learn
Librarians and student artists lead monthly workshops about designing custom t-shirts, crochet, 3D printing and weaving bracelets. The library provides all materials at no charge!
Maker Fair
We hosted the first annual Shreve Maker Fair in the library Wednesday, April 12, 2023 and continue to hold this event in April each year.
The event showcased 24 Shreve creators, designers, innovators, artists, and entrepreneurs. It was great to see students showing off their talent!! They were so proud and we could see their confidence grow more and more as visitors came through the event. Speaking publicly about their craft was a good learning experience for these young entrepreneurs, designers and artists.
Student displays included 3D Design and printing, sewing & fashion, painting, crochet, charcoal, and custom Vinyl T-shirts. We will also kept our Shreve Library Maker Space items on display and offered some demonstrations. More than 100 students visited on each lunch shift. The library was buzzing!
